How Much Does a Chromebook Weigh? [2024]

A Chromebook typically weighs between 2.2 to 3.3 pounds.

Chromebooks have become popular due to their lightweight and portable design, making them a convenient choice for students, travelers, and professionals on the go.

One of the key factors contributing to their portability is their weight, which ranges from 2.2 to 3.3 pounds on average.

This makes Chromebooks significantly lighter than traditional laptops, allowing users to easily carry them in backpacks or bags without feeling weighed down.

II. Factors Affecting the Weight of Chromebooks

When considering the weight of a Chromebook, there are several factors that can contribute to its overall heaviness.

These factors include:

  1. Screen Size: The size of the screen can significantly impact the weight of a Chromebook. Larger screens generally require more materials, which can add to the overall weight. If portability is a priority for you, consider opting for a smaller screen size.
  2. Build Material: The choice of build material can also affect the weight of a Chromebook. Some models are made from lightweight materials such as aluminum or carbon fiber, while others may use heavier materials like plastic. Keep this in mind when selecting a Chromebook, especially if you plan on carrying it around frequently.
  3. Battery Size: The size and capacity of the battery can impact the weight of a Chromebook. A larger battery may provide longer battery life, but it can also add to the overall weight. If you prioritize battery life, be prepared for a slightly heavier device.
  4. Internal Components: The internal components, such as the processor, memory, and storage, can also affect the weight of a Chromebook. More powerful components may require additional cooling mechanisms, which can add weight to the device. Consider your usage needs and prioritize the components accordingly.
  5. Additional Features: Some Chromebooks come with additional features like touchscreens, 2-in-1 convertible designs, or stylus support. While these features can enhance usability, they can also contribute to the weight of the device. Evaluate whether these features are essential for your needs or if you can compromise on weight.

By considering these factors, you can make an informed decision when selecting a Chromebook that strikes the right balance between weight and functionality.

IV. Tips for Choosing the Right Weight for Your Chromebook

When it comes to choosing the right weight for your Chromebook, there are a few important factors to consider.

Here are some tips to help you make the best decision:

  1. Consider your usage: Think about how you plan to use your Chromebook. If you will be carrying it around frequently, a lightweight option may be more suitable. On the other hand, if you primarily use your Chromebook on a desk or table, weight may not be as much of a concern.
  2. Think about portability: If you travel often or need to take your Chromebook with you on the go, a lighter model will be easier to carry and will take up less space in your bag. Look for compact and slim designs that prioritize portability.
  3. Consider durability: While lighter Chromebooks may be more portable, they may also be less durable. If you anticipate rough handling or frequently dropping your device, you may want to opt for a slightly heavier model that offers more robust construction and protection.
  4. Check the battery life: The weight of a Chromebook can sometimes be indicative of its battery life. Lighter models may have smaller batteries, which could result in shorter usage time. Consider your power needs and choose a Chromebook with a battery that aligns with your usage requirements.
  5. Read reviews: Before making a final decision, take the time to read reviews from other users. Pay attention to any comments about the weight of the Chromebook and how it affects the overall user experience. Real-life feedback can provide valuable insights that may help you make a more informed choice.

Conclusion: How Much Does a Chromebook Weigh

As an expert in Chromebooks, I can confidently say that the weight of a Chromebook varies depending on the model. On average, a typical Chromebook weighs around 2.5 to 3.5 pounds (1.1 to 1.6 kilograms).

However, it is essential to note that some Chromebooks may be lighter or heavier than this range. When considering purchasing a Chromebook, it is always advisable to check the specifications provided by the manufacturer for the accurate weight.
